Qualifications
To become a driving instructor, you must satisfy certain requirements that are set by the state where you'd like to work. Some prerequisites are a high-school diploma or GED and a valid driving license with a clean record and prior driving experience. You may be required to pass a driving test as well as an examination written.
The course will show how to create an instructional plan for driving, explain traffic laws in your state, and then practice safe driving. The course will also give you the opportunity to conduct driving lessons on the road with students. Depending on your state the program can run from a few days to a few months.
During the time of observation, you'll observe experienced driving instructors as they teach students. This will help you get an understanding of what the job entails and will help you acquire the skills needed to become a competent driving instructor. You'll also need to have liability insurance. Your employer can provide this for you.
After your observation period, you'll be required to take the written exam. This test covers the contents of the Commissioner's Regulations, the Driver's Manual and other information. After passing the written test you will be required to take the instructor's Tony Mac Driving Courses test. This test will let you demonstrate your abilities as a teacher and driver.
After you have passed the tests, you need to fill out the New York DMV form MV-523. Then, you will receive an instructor certificate, which allows you to instruct drivers at the driving school that is listed on the form. Students who wish to instruct the Pre-Licensing Program must complete a 30-hour Methods and Content Course for In-Car Instruction which is offered at a variety of community colleges and driving schools that have been approved by the Commissioner. Candidates must also be authorized to operate the type of vehicle on which they will be instructing and be able to do so without restrictions.
Licensing requirements
The requirements for licensing driving instructors vary from state to state, but typically include a driver's license and clean driving record, as in addition to an endorsement from an instructor training institute or a professional association. Instructors must also possess excellent communication skills, and the ability to give constructive feedback and remain calm in stressful situations. The job requires a thorough knowledge of driving and various teaching methods including classroom instruction and behind-the-wheel instruction.
Before they can be granted the driving instructor's certificate applicants must pass an exam in writing and pass a behind-the-wheel teacher's course. To teach at a driving school the instructor must be approved by the DMV and must pass the 30-hour Methods and Content Course for In-Car Instruction (or MCCII). If an instructor wants to instruct the Pre-Licensing class in a classroom, they will need to complete a 30-hour course referred to as Instructor Teaching Techniques.
A driving instructor should have at least three years' experience in the commercial vehicle industry. They must also be free of any suspensions or cancellations. The driving instructor must also be able demonstrate that they are conversant with different vehicles as well as their safety features and how to operate them. It is recommended that the instructor obtain an CDL instructor training program that has been endorsed by the New York Department of Motor Vehicles to be licensed.
After they have completed their training, instructors must pass an exam to receive their ADI license. The test includes the written portion, where students are asked questions regarding the laws of driving, their knowledge of vehicles and safety regulations. The exam also includes a practical section where candidates are observed during their first lesson, and evaluated on their ability of conveying information effectively.
Driving instructors must carry their certificate with them when they instruct students and when accompanying students to the road test site in the vehicle. If an instructor loses their certificate, they must immediately report it to the DMV. They can then request a duplicate. After approval after which the DMV will send an additional certificate to the instructor. The original certificate of an instructor is valid for two years and expires at the expiration date of the 12th calendar month following the date it was issued.

The primary responsibility of driving instructors is to teach people how to operate the vehicle safely and effectively. This includes teaching about the various parts and functions, road rules, and the practical skills associated with driving. In addition, they should also help students gain confidence in their driving abilities and assess their performance.
They must also guide students through maintenance of their vehicles and give instruction on driving tests. They must also administer mock tests to familiarize learners with the exam format and reduce anxiety during tests. They should also report the student's performance to the head of their driving school.
